Fueling the Marathon: SNICKERS’ 10,000-Bar Giveaway
In a major bid to energize runners and spectators alike for the highly anticipated Hong Kong Marathon on January 18, 2026, SNICKERS will distribute an impressive 10,000 chocolate bars across key areas in Causeway Bay. The event, scheduled from 8:00 AM to 2:00 PM (subject to change based on conditions) near Victoria Park and Paterson Street, aims to provide a much-needed boost to participants crossing the finish line and supporters cheering them on.
The handout will feature two specific varieties. Returning by popular demand is the Half-Sugar Almond Dark Chocolate Bar, a favored choice among athletes. This reduced-sugar formulation combines intense dark chocolate with crunchy almonds, offering approximately 101 calories per individually wrapped portion—a precise and relatively low-calorie source of post-exercise fuel. Adding a touch of novelty, the brand is also debuting a brand-new Strawberry Chocolate Bar, infusing the classic rich chocolate taste with a sweet, fruit-forward profile. Brand ambassadors will be on the ground distributing the free treats and associated coupons.
Tim Ho Wan Introduces Black Truffle Twist to Classic Dim Sum
Meanwhile, culinary enthusiasts are focused on Tim Ho Wan, the globally recognized Michelin-starred dim sum establishment. Famed for its iconic Baked BBQ Pork Buns (Snowy Char Siu Pao), the restaurant is shaking up the menu with the limited-edition ‘Dual Delight’ Crisp Pastry Set just in time for the new year.
This innovative set, which melds tradition with luxury, presents two distinct flavors in one box. One half is the beloved classic酥皮叉燒包 (Crispy Char Siu Pao), boasting its signature flaky crust and savory pork filling. The second piece is the opulent Crispy Black Truffle Chicken Bun, which substitutes the conventional pork filling with tender chicken breast and highly aromatic black truffle, creating a visually striking and palate-pleasing dark pastry. The launch is being promoted by popular local duo FAMA (C Chun and Luk Wing), and even features custom black-and-white dining sets designed by local artist Queenie Wong.

Beyond the new pastry, Tim Ho Wan is ushering in the Lunar New Year (starting January 19) with a selection of culturally significant dishes, including the golden Salted Egg Yolk Scallop Crispy Puff (shaped like ingots), the fragrant Wine-Infused Steamed Chicken with Rice, and the crisp New Year Cake Slice, all designed to symbolize good fortune and prosperity in the coming year.
